Crystal Light is a great way to add a sweet taste to your recipes without the sugar. This also works very well with hard candy. You can enjoy a sweet delicious treat without all the sugar and calories. You can even substitute the sugar that you do use with molasses for a less processed but still delicious flavor. Combine Crystal Light, molasses, corn syrup, and water in a saucepan. Cook on medium stirring constantly until Crystal Light dissolves. When the temperature reaches 250 degrees, add food coloring When the temperature reaches 300 degrees remove from heat. Pour into lightly oiled candy molds. Cool and take out of the molds.
